Oracle登录失败请检查您的认证信息(oracle-01017)
Oracle登录失败:请检查您的认证信息!
Oracle是业内领先的关系型数据库管理系统,是许多企业和组织的首选数据库。但是,有时候我们尝试登录Oracle时会遇到“登录失败:请检查您的认证信息!”的问题。此时我们该怎么办呢?
我们需要确认用户名和密码是否正确。我们可能会出现输入错误的情况,这时候我们需要核对自己的账户名和密码,确保它们与数据库管理员提供给我们的账户信息一致。
如果账户信息没有问题,那么可能是我们的连接信息出现了问题。我们需要检查我们连接Oracle数据库的信息是否正确,如IP地址、端口、数据库实例名等。例如,在我们连接Oracle数据库时使用的用户名和密码是system和oracle;对应的数据库实例名为orcl,在SQL Developer的连接界面应该是这样设置的:
在连接界面中我们需要确保,我们输入的连接信息与我们连接数据库时的信息是一致的。
如果连接信息也没有错误,我们就需要检查数据库服务是否启动。使用以下命令确认Oracle数据库服务是否已经启动:
“`bash
lsnrctl status
如果服务没有启动,我们需要使用以下命令启动:
```bashlsnrctl start
如果上述方法都没有解决问题,那么可能是我们正在连接的Oracle实例中某些资源出现了问题。我们可以使用以下命令测试登录Oracle:
“`bash
sqlplus /nolog
conn username/password@oracle_address
如果能够成功登录而在连接JDBC或ODBC时仍然失败,则可能是Oracle客户端出现了问题。您可能需要重新安装Oracle客户端,或者确保您使用的Oracle客户端与Oracle服务器版本兼容。
总结一下,当我们遇到“Oracle登录失败:请检查您的认证信息!”的问题时,最好的处理方法是:
1. 确认用户名和密码是否正确
2. 检查连接信息是否正确
3. 确认数据库服务是否启动
4. 测试登录Oracle
5. 重新安装Oracle客户端
希望以上方法能够帮助你解决Oracle登录问题!